Output afdbe50a3c4f712e99c32047570d5523330556c204795e750b05c394a6a406ea:0

value
4126025
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5b88517673080584b879308a6e99a617fea486d OP_EQUAL
address
3MB4u52XoUKkAYgRLKRJXi5omY5cd28bTe
transaction
afdbe50a3c4f712e99c32047570d5523330556c204795e750b05c394a6a406ea
confirmations
535770
spent
true